The Akai iPK25 Still Lives?

It's listed for $99 on the Nova Musik website here. No release date listed, but according to Chris in the comments of this post, Guitar Center and Musician's Friend have the release date listed as March 3rd. Still nothing on the Akai site.

Update: I heard from Akai. It is still on track, same price and release date. The name has officially changed to the SynthStation25. The info page was removed at Apple's request.

"The Akai iPK25...now renamed SynthStation25 does in fact live. When developing hardware for Apple ipod products, Apple has a large number of hoops for developers to jump through. There was one hoop we missed so Apple made us take down the information from our web page. We are now working our way through this issue and it will be back up on the web page when we are allowed to put it back there. This has not affected shipping dates or anything, just our ability to have info regarding it up on our web page."

A New World in Synthesis


YouTube via Pic2008Lex

Note the above video does not feature any synths. It is a concept video for a tablet UI. The hardware looks like the majority of artist renders for the upcoming Apple iPad/iSlate. If you haven't heard, tomorrow, Apple will announce their new tablet device. Rumor is it will essentially be an iTouch with a 10" screen, more power, memory and may have the ability to run multiple apps at the same time. [Update: it most likely will]

Why is this a new world in synthesis? In short this is a new hardware platform for synthesis. Yes it is an extension of the iTouch platform, but the obvious key difference and game changer in my opinion will be the size of the screen. For example, imagine controlling all of your synths running Numerology on the device in that video. Imagine interfacing with your modular with a UI optimized version of VOLTA or Expert Sleepers. Imagine running Way Out Ware's iSample, or how about an ARP2600 emulation with sliders. Imagine running Audio Damage's tattoo on one, etc. And don't forget the accelorometer. Processing power, additional memory, and potentially running multiple apps at once will only add to the advantage the slate will have over the iTouch.
